The Perfect Two-Hour Escape

Looking for a quick way to unwind? Rebecca Jasmine’s A Pickleball Girl's Second Chance Christmas is a cozy novella designed to be devoured in just about two hours. Whether you’re relaxing after a tournament or looking for a light read during your holiday travel downtime, this story is the perfect fit.

The Plot: The story follows a young Los Angeles social media influencer who flees to the sunny (and fictional) Whisper Hills Country Club in Palm Springs after a humiliating breakup. There, she reconnects with Charlie, her teenage heartbreak. The pair embarks on a Christmas Eve adventure to find a lost yellow lab, rediscovering more than just a missing pup along the way.

Why We Love It

While most holiday stories take place in snowy cabins, Jasmine brings a fresh twist by setting the scene in sunny Palm Springs. As an avid pickleball fan herself—drawing inspiration from her home club which hosts the PPA Masters—Jasmine seamlessly weaves the sport into a "closed-door" romance. Think of it as a Nora Ephron film, but with paddles and perfect dinks!
